随着人工智能、大数据、云计算等技术的迅猛发展,Python在各领域的需求持续增长,催生了大量与Python相关的职业岗位。作为一名拥有十余年经验的Python学习者,坤辉学知网edu.eoifi.cn始终致力于帮助学员掌握Python的核心技能,并为他们提供清晰的职业发展路径。本文将从职业方向、技能要求、行业应用、职业发展建议等方面,系统阐述学Python可以从事的工作,并结合实际案例,为读者提供全面的攻略。 --- 一、学Python可以做什么工作:职业方向概述 Python作为一种通用编程语言,广泛应用于软件开发、数据分析、机器学习、Web开发、自动化运维、游戏开发、金融科技、物联网等多个领域。
随着技术的不断进步,Python的使用场景也在不断扩展,形成了一条从初级到高级的职业发展通道。 1.软件开发与系统维护 Python在Web开发中扮演着重要角色,可用于开发动态网站、API接口、后端服务等。开发者可以从事全栈开发、后端开发、移动应用开发等岗位。 2.数据分析与可视化 Python拥有丰富的数据处理和分析库,如Pandas、NumPy、Matplotlib、Seaborn等,适用于数据清洗、统计分析、数据可视化等工作。 3.机器学习与人工智能 Python是机器学习和人工智能领域的主流语言,开发者可以从事数据科学家、AI工程师、深度学习研究员等岗位,利用Python进行模型训练、算法优化、模型部署等工作。 4.自动化与运维 Python在自动化脚本、系统管理、任务调度等方面具有强大优势,可用于自动化部署、脚本编写、运维工具开发等。 5.游戏开发与影视特效 Python在游戏开发中也有一定的应用,特别是在游戏引擎的脚本编写和特效开发中,如使用Pygame、Godot等工具进行游戏开发。 6.金融科技与区块链 Python在金融领域广泛应用于风险管理、量化交易、数据分析、区块链开发等,成为金融科技从业者的重要技能。 7.物联网与嵌入式开发 Python在物联网设备控制、传感器数据采集、嵌入式系统开发等领域也有一定应用,特别是在Linux平台下的开发中。 --- 二、学Python可以做什么工作:技能要求与职业发展路径 1.基础能力 - 熟练掌握Python语法、数据结构与算法 - 熟悉主流开发框架(如Django、Flask、React、Vue等) - 了解版本控制工具(如Git) 2.进阶能力 - 熟悉数据分析工具(如Pandas、NumPy、SQL) - 熟练使用机器学习库(如Scikit-learn、TensorFlow、PyTorch) - 熟悉Web开发框架(如Django、Flask、FastAPI) - 熟悉自动化脚本编写与部署(如Ansible、Chef、Salt) 3.职业发展路径 - 初级岗位:Python开发工程师、数据分析师、自动化脚本开发者 - 中级岗位:数据科学家、AI工程师、Web开发工程师 - 高级岗位:架构师、项目经理、技术总监 --- 三、学Python可以做什么工作:行业应用与案例分析 1.数据科学与人工智能 Python是数据科学和人工智能领域的首选语言。许多公司招聘数据科学家时,要求候选人具备Python编程能力。
例如,某金融科技公司招聘数据分析师,要求候选人具备使用Pandas、NumPy进行数据清洗和分析的能力,同时熟悉Scikit-learn进行模型训练。 2.Web开发与API开发 以某电商平台为例,其后端开发工程师需要使用Python开发动态网站和API接口。使用Django或Flask框架,编写用户管理系统、订单处理系统、支付接口等,是常见的工作内容。 3.自动化与运维 某IT运维公司需要Python开发者编写自动化脚本,实现系统部署、任务监控、日志分析等功能。Python的简洁语法和丰富的库,使其成为自动化脚本的首选语言。 4.游戏开发与影视特效 某游戏公司使用Python开发游戏脚本,利用Pygame库进行游戏开发。
除了这些以外呢,Python也被用于影视特效的图形处理和动画制作。 5.金融科技与区块链 某区块链平台需要Python开发者进行智能合约开发、数据处理、交易验证等。Python在区块链领域的应用,主要集中在以太坊等平台上,开发者需要掌握区块链开发框架和编程语言。 --- 四、学Python可以做什么工作:职业发展建议与成长路径 1.持续学习与技能提升 - 学习新的Python库和框架,如TensorFlow、PyTorch、Streamlit等 - 参与开源项目,提升代码能力与项目经验 - 学习数据科学、机器学习、人工智能等前沿技术 2.积累项目经验 - 参与实际项目,提升实战能力 - 将项目经验转化为简历,展示个人能力 - 参与技术社区,分享经验,提升影响力 3.建立人脉与职业网络 - 参与技术论坛、会议、线下活动,结识同行 - 加入技术社区,如GitHub、Stack Overflow、Reddit等 - 与行业专家合作,提升职业发展机会 4.职业规划与转型 - 根据兴趣和市场需求,选择适合自己的发展方向 - 考取相关认证,如Python开发者认证、数据分析师认证等 - 持续关注行业动态,及时调整职业方向 --- 五、归结起来说 Python作为一种强大的编程语言,正在各行业中发挥着重要作用。无论是软件开发、数据分析、人工智能,还是自动化运维、游戏开发、金融科技等领域,Python都具有广泛的应用前景。作为一名学习Python的从业者,通过不断学习、实践和积累,能够在这个充满机遇的行业中找到适合自己的职业路径。 坤辉学知网edu.eoifi.cn,作为专注于Python学习与职业发展的平台,始终致力于帮助学员掌握Python的核心技能,提升实战能力,为在以后的职业发展打下坚实基础。无论你是初学者还是有经验的开发者,只要持续学习、勇于实践,Python都能为你带来无限可能。 ---
本文内容结合了当前Python行业的发展趋势和实际应用场景,为有志于学习Python的读者提供了清晰的职业发展路径和实用的技能提升建议。通过不断学习与实践,Python开发者将能够在众多行业中找到适合自己的发展机会。






